Police in Ringwood are appealing for witnesses after a man with learning difficulties was robbed.
The incident occurred close to the public toilets in Meeting House Lane, Ringwood, on Friday, October 10, sometime between 3 and 4.30pm.
The 35-year-old local man was approached by his robber who demanded money. When the man refused, the robber pushed him against a wall. Fearing for his safety the man handed over five pounds.
The incident left the man traumatised but otherwise uninjured.
He described his attacker as:
- Asian appearance
- Aged approx 40 years
- 5ft 10ins tall
- Well built
- Medium dark hair collar length
- Clean shaven
- He was wearing a tracksuit and white jacket.
